Hi everyone.
I have found (what I believe is) a clever function when creating electrical drawing, where I can place a switch on the page, right click it and the first item in the sub-menu will let me change the switch type from open to closed, or even its appearance. I have attached screen grabs of what I'm talking about. I want to create my own switch where I can also select options which change the appearance of the shape, but do not know what this function is called, let alone how to create. As a relative newbie, any help gratefully appreciated! Phil |
